IMHO an album can be a song when it has a cohesive theme that is supported by the several pieces of music. Much the same way the libretto of an opera is supported by the several pieces of music in it.
Pink Floyd's The Wall is a clear example of an album that constitutes a song because each piece expresses a unique portion of the overall narrative of the album. The several pieces of music can be heard and enjoyed separately but to get the full impression of the artistic message the entire album should be heard as a song at one time.
